WebSep 3, 2024 · The policy itself reduces no-show rates. Many practices find that communicating the policy alone decreases no-show rates. When your patients know there’s a consequence for late cancellations, they know to try their best to show up or let you know of the cancellation in advance. If you must cancel a session, at least 24 hours-notice … WebCancellation Policy We understand that unanticipated events happen occasionally in everyone’s life. In our desire to be effective and fair to all clients, the following policies are honored: 24 hour advance notice is required when cancelling an appointment. This allows the opportunity for someone else to schedule an appointment.
